Abstract:
A vehicle (2) comprises a plurality of vehicle lights (14a-k) to be matched by additional lights (8a-j) in use; respective connecting interfaces (20a-20h) associated with each of the vehicle lights (14a-k); and an electronic controller (24) for controlling supply of light-activating power to the vehicle lights (14a-k) and to the associated connecting interfaces (20a-20h). The controller (24) is configured, in a light testing mode, to supply said power to each of the vehicle lights (14a-k) and to each of the associated connecting interfaces (20a-20h) in a sequence for inspecting whether additional lights (8a-j) connected in use to the connecting interfaces (20a-20h) match the vehicle lights (14a-k). Related systems, methods and controllers are also described.
